Certified Professional in Design Thinking: UK Job Market Overview
The UK design thinking job market is booming, with high demand for professionals across various sectors. This section provides insights into key roles and salary expectations, empowering you to navigate your career path effectively.
| Role |
Description |
Salary Range (GBP) |
| UX Designer (Design Thinking) |
Applies design thinking principles to create user-centered digital experiences. |
£35,000 - £70,000 |
| Service Designer (Design Thinking) |
Utilizes design thinking methodologies to improve service delivery and customer journeys. |
£40,000 - £80,000 |
| Design Thinking Consultant |
Leads design thinking workshops and projects, advising organizations on innovation strategies. |
£50,000 - £100,000 |
| Innovation Manager (Design Thinking) |
Drives innovation initiatives within organizations, employing a design thinking-centric approach. |
£60,000 - £120,000 |

The Certified Professional in Design Thinking program provides a comprehensive understanding of design thinking methodologies, equipping participants with the skills to innovate and solve complex problems effectively. Successful completion leads to a valuable certification, enhancing career prospects.
Learning outcomes for a Certified Professional in Design Thinking include mastering the five stages of the design thinking process (Empathize, Define, Ideate, Prototype, Test), developing effective communication and collaboration skills within multidisciplinary teams, and confidently applying human-centered design principles to real-world challenges. Participants also learn various design tools and techniques, including user research, storyboarding, and rapid prototyping.
Program duration varies depending on the provider, but generally ranges from a few days (intensive workshops) to several months (online courses with self-paced modules). Many programs incorporate interactive exercises, case studies, and project-based learning to reinforce knowledge and practical application of design thinking principles.
